Query Construction
Search terms should be content-bearing words that discriminate between sessions — high information value words that are rare enough to rank relevant sessions above irrelevant ones. BM25 ranking (when FTS5 is available) weights rare terms higher automatically.
Include: specific nouns, technologies, concepts, project names, domain terms, unique phrases. More terms improve ranking precision.
Exclude: generic verbs ("discuss", "talk"), time markers ("yesterday"), vague nouns ("thing", "stuff"), meta-conversation words ("conversation", "chat") — these appear in nearly every session and add noise rather than signal.
Algorithm:
- Extract substantive keywords from user request
- If 0 keywords, ask for clarification ("Which project specifically?")
- If 1+ specific terms, search with those terms; use
--projectto narrow scope
Synthesis
Principles
- Prioritize significance — 3-5 key findings, not exhaustive lists
- Be specific — file paths, dates, project names
- Make it actionable — every finding suggests a response
- Show evidence — quotes or references
- Keep it scannable — clear structure, no walls of text
